Transaction 66ae25ffd56a5f98231fd8d29020782c16d45aa9752fd3cb00d501b6bc24a677

1 Input
2 Outputs
  • 66ae25ffd56a5f98231fd8d29020782c16d45aa9752fd3cb00d501b6bc24a677:0
  • value  1023667867
    address  17kmYmsSEREaiEx8MmQJi9Hk6GCr38bkDL
  • 66ae25ffd56a5f98231fd8d29020782c16d45aa9752fd3cb00d501b6bc24a677:1
  • value  7914098
    address  14ndhGC8wA8eZqW8DnTXEXtyX2xRwEANvX